Pro Tip: Always conduct electroluminescence testing before deciding to repair or recycle damaged panels. This non-invasive method reveals microcracks invisible to the naked eye.
FAQ: Your Top Questions Answered
Can water enter through cracked solar glass?
Most modern panels use multiple encapsulation layers that prevent moisture ingress even with surface cracks. However, deep fractures compromising the EVA layer require immediate attention.
How does repair cost compare to replacement?
Field repairs typically cost 35-60% less than full replacements. For large commercial arrays, mobile repair units can service 200+ panels daily.
